Shannon D. Smith was appointed the sixth Executive Director and CEO for the Wyoming Humanities Council in 2013. Prior to that she was an associate director and research fellow at EDUCAUSE in Boulder, Colorado and taught history and humanities for seven years at Oglala Lakota College on the Pine Ridge Indian Reservation. She is a historian and author of several works on women of the American West including “Give Me Eighty Men”: Women and the Myth of the Fetterman Fight, a 2009 book award winner from the Wyoming State Historical Society. She continues to research and write history and publishes a monthly article on the creative and cultural network of Wyoming in the Casper Star-Tribune.
